John S. Herbert is a partner in the law firm of McDermott Will & Emery LLP and is base in the Firm's New York office. John is a senior member of the Firm’s private equity, mergers & acquisitions and securities practices. He is the principal relationship partner for several of the Firm’s private equity fund clients, including funds active in North America and other international markets. He also advises private equity fund bankers and portfolio company managers.
Chambers Global Guide 2009 and Chambers USA: America’s Leading Lawyers for Business 2008 ranked John among the top private equity lawyers. He was also ranked as one of the leading lawyers in the private equity business by both the International Financial Law Review 1000 and Euromoney’s Guide to the World’s Leading Private Equity Lawyers.
He has over 25 years experience representing U.S. and international financial buyers in the private equity area and a wide variety of other clients in complex mergers and acquisitions transactions.
He advises private equity funds in connection with their portfolio investments in public and private companies, including initial acquisitions and platform startups, divestitures, add-on acquisitions, leveraged loan financings and high-yield offerings, and various exit transactions, including dispositions, initial public offerings and recapitalizations. He has played the leading role in organizing teams of lawyers in the mergers and acquisitions, compensations and benefits, tax, financing and other areas of practice and executing a variety of private equity control acquisitions or dispositions, minority investments and other related transactions.
John also advises private equity portfolio company management teams on their participation in buyouts and other private equity investments by funds. He leads interdisciplinary teams of executive compensation, tax, trusts and estates and securities lawyers to help portfolio company managers achieve their equity incentive and compensation objectives over the life of a fund's investment in the managers' employer. His advice also includes a focus on managers' issues with employers in distressed situations.
John also represents private equity fund sponsors in connection with the formation and operation of private equity funds, as well as fund bankers on their employment and incentive compensation arrangements with funds. He also counsels sponsors and employees of other newly formed financial firms.
